Explosion Protection Market Size
The global Explosion Protection Market Size was USD 10.95 billion in 2024 and is forecast to grow to USD 11.98 billion in 2025 and USD 24.59 billion by 2033, reflecting a strong CAGR of 9.4% during the forecast period (2025–2033). Demand is fueled by strict safety regulations and industrial risk mitigation.
In the US, the Explosion Protection Market is expanding due to increasing safety standards in oil & gas, mining, chemical processing, and food industries. Technological advancements in detection systems and explosion-proof equipment also enhance market outlook.

RESTRAINT
" High cost and complexity in compliance and certification"
Approximately 42% of small and medium enterprises delay explosion protection implementation due to cost barriers. Certification processes for ATEX and IECEx add an average of 29% more to equipment costs. Maintenance and replacement raise lifecycle costs by 33%, limiting adoption across low-budget operations. Training and regulatory audits add another 21% to total operational expenses. Around 39% of facilities find integration with legacy equipment difficult, requiring extensive modification and downtime. Compliance verification accounts for nearly 25% of deployment time in new projects. These combined restraints impact over 47% of small-scale manufacturers and significantly slow adoption across underdeveloped industrial regions.
CHALLENGE
" Integration of explosion protection systems in outdated facilities"
Approximately 44% of industrial sites globally still operate with outdated machinery incompatible with modern explosion protection technologies. Around 36% of project delays stem from system incompatibility. Retrofitting older facilities increases overall deployment time by 32% and installation costs by 37%. Over 49% of facility managers lack technical staff trained to handle explosion-proof equipment integration. Software interoperability issues affect 28% of explosion protection system installations in developing regions. Standardization remains inconsistent, causing 34% of OEMs to struggle with product approvals. Legacy infrastructures in oil, gas, and mining industries account for 39% of all integration challenges today.
